‘I expect him to play’: Sutton thinks GVB is going to start ‘incredible’ Rangers star against Braga tonight

Chris Sutton expects Aaron Ramsey to play a starring role for Rangers in their Europa League clash with Braga tonight.

On Sutton said that the Welshman, who was on the bench for the first leg, when Rangers went down 1-0 in Portugal, should come in.

He also suggested that would go some way to making up for the absence of Alfredo Morelos, who has been sensational for Rangers in European competition.

“I think in the first leg they didn’t show enough attacking intent, they were really poor in the final third,” said Sutton.

“But it’s a tie I think Rangers can win and I think Rangers will go through if they play to the level they are capable of.

“No Aaron Ramsey in the first leg. He was on the bench and Van Bronckhorst didn’t bring him on, but I expect him to play a prominent role tomorrow night.

“They are missing Morelos though and that’s a big deal, he’s European record has been phenomenal for Rangers but I do think it would be a big opportunity missed if Rangers go out to this Braga team.”
